2C0S

NMR Solution Structure of a protein aspartic acid phosphate phosphatase from Bacillus Anthracis

Summary for 2C0S
Entry DOI10.2210/pdb2c0s/pdb
NMR InformationBMRB: 7349
DescriptorCONSERVED DOMAIN PROTEIN (1 entity in total)
Functional Keywordstransferase, phosphatase, phosphorylation, sporulation, bacillus anthracis, antithetical, negative regulator, spine
Biological sourceBacillus anthracis str. Ames
Total number of polymer chains1
Total formula weight7826.21
Authors
Grenha, R.,Rzechorzek, N.J.,Brannigan, J.A.,Ab, E.,Folkers, G.E.,De Jong, R.N.,Diercks, T.,Wilkinson, A.J.,Kaptein, R.,Wilson, K.S. (deposition date: 2005-09-07, release date: 2006-09-25, Last modification date: 2018-05-09)
Primary citationGrenha, R.,Rzechorzek, N.J.,Brannigan, J.A.,de Jong, R.N.,Ab, E.,Diercks, T.,Truffault, V.,Ladds, J.C.,Fogg, M.J.,Bongiorni, C.,Perego, M.,Kaptein, R.,Wilson, K.S.,Folkers, G.E.,Wilkinson, A.J.
Structural characterization of Spo0E-like protein-aspartic acid phosphatases that regulate sporulation in bacilli.
J. Biol. Chem., 281:37993-38003, 2006
